The progression of digital casino platforms
The earliest era of web wagering platforms appeared in the mid-1990s, presenting limited game choices through simple programs demanding lengthy installations. Early sites offered rudimentary imagery and slow loading durations, limiting usability to users with rapid access. These pioneering sites created basis for substantial market change.

Personalization and suggestion platforms
Systems accumulate behavioral information to comprehend individual tastes and tailor experiences correspondingly. Recording systems record which titles users engage most regularly, how long periods persist, and what gaming patterns develop over duration. This intelligence flows into algorithms generating personalized game proposals, raising the probability that users find content matching their tastes.
Suggestion systems use shared sorting techniques, identifying parallels between participants with equivalent engagement patterns. When one participant likes particular options, the platform proposes those same entertainment to different users exhibiting comparable activity profiles. Feature-based analysis examines game properties such as styles, features, and volatility ratings to propose options possessing attributes with earlier played options.
